When Corporations Leave Town: The Cost and Benefits of Metropolitan Job Sprawl
more books like this
by
Joseph Persky, Wim Wiewel
An examination of the benefits and consequences to cities when companies relocate to the suburbs. Theoretic models of a manufacturing plant and a business services office in the Chicago area illustrate such phenomena as suburban wealth creation, increased traffic congestion and housing abandonment.

Cities on the Shore: The Urban Littoral Frontier
more books like this
by
Brian J Hudson
An in-depth analysis of land reclamation which sees it as a normal, if not essential form of urban development for cities situated on bodies of water. This is a wide-reaching survey using many examples and case studies, and is illustrated with photos and maps.
